The Inner Technology Field Map

Inner Technology sits at the intersection of several urgent conversations, but it is not identical to any of them.

Its distinct contribution is human capacity infrastructure.

“The field bridge”

A missing center

Responsible AI asks: how should intelligent systems be built and governed?

Digital wellbeing asks: how can people live well with technology?

Inner development asks: what inner qualities support better futures?

Future education asks: what must humans learn now?

Embodied intelligence asks: how does the body participate in knowing?

Inner Technology asks: what capacities must humans intentionally develop so technological acceleration does not outpace human maturity?

Core Distinctions

Why the distinction matters

Without boundaries, Inner Technology becomes a vague blend of wellness, ethics, education, and AI commentary.

With boundaries, it becomes useful. It can support policy, education, responsible AI, practice environments, institutional readiness, and cultural design.

The field bridge

Inner Technology does not replace existing fields. It gives them a missing human-capacity layer.
